Random sum-free subsets of Abelian groups

Abstract

We characterize the structure of maximum-size sum-free subsets of a random subset of an Abelian group GG. In particular, we determine the threshold pclogn/np_c \approx \sqrt{\log n / n} above which, with high probability as G|G| \to \infty, each such subset is contained in a maximum-size sum-free subset of GG, whenever qq divides G|G| for some (fixed) prime qq with q2(mod3)q \equiv 2 \pmod 3. Moreover, in the special case G=\ZZ2nG = \ZZ_{2n}, we determine a sharp threshold for the above property. The proof uses recent 'transference' theorems of Conlon and Gowers, together with stability theorems for sum-free subsets of Abelian groups.
